Hello plugin authors,

Next Thursday, Corbexa will run a disaster-recovery drill for the RestockRoute vending-machine restock planner. During the failover window, plugin callbacks will be replayed against the standby scheduler, so please ensure your handlers are idempotent and tolerate duplicate route assignments. No customer restock data will be altered. To re-register your plugin against the standby environment during the drill, authenticate with the recovery passphrase provided below.

vault phrase of hahip-tajeg = quenax-briath-briax

## Changed defaults: bulk edits in the Ledgerette admin table

Starting with 4.2, bulk edits now apply optimistically with a server-side batch cap of 250 rows, and partial failures no longer abort the whole batch. Plugin hooks fire once per batch, not per row. The new default configuration for the bulk-edit service follows.

settings of tagef-bawif:
DRUIX_HOST=druix.zemvarlabs.internal
DRUIX_PORT=8000

Changelog — GreenhouseBrain v1.9. For new team members: we renamed DRIFT_COMP_TOKEN to SENSOR_DRIFT_API_SECRET. The old name suggested it controlled drift compensation math, but it's actually the credential for the drift-calibration service that recalibrates humidity sensors nightly. The compensation coefficients moved to DRIFT_COEFFS and are not secret. The deprecated name will be removed in v2.0, so update your local .env now. After the existing DRIFT_COEFFS line, the renamed credential goes on the following line.

vault entry, yahif-yajep: COURIER_KEY29=b802bdf8034096b65a51c6ba5abe2